I can see some situations where rdm tanking is still viable.
1) Lord ruthven: I've co-tanked this several times with a pld. If you have Sam/thfs they can provide a good deal of CE when the mob is turned away form you. I rarely had to touch sleep or dispel and you could keep cap ce with cures and occasional ta. Maintain ve with poison spam.
RDM is still a brick wall, anytime rdm can receive large amounts of ce from ta damage at regular intervals, it should be able to a) keep itself alive and b) maintain ve through poison spam. Ruthven is a perfect example because you won't really face the mob to be whacking away with a sword anyway.
Can anyone explain to me a good reason to nerf blind and bind without touching poison? Blind may have been slightly more time/mp efficient than poison, but poison is still a viable ve gainer. My only guess is that they left it to leave nin/drk tanking a tool for emnity.
2) Possibly JoL (with massive mdt gear). Rdm/pld / rdm/drk still has a fair amount of ce gain. Take into account that rdm can still negate magic dmg better than pld and doesn't need shadows.
Ouryu maybe. I'm kind of having trouble seeing where you are getting ce gain on armed gears. Its been a while since i did the fight.
